As of Friday, Print Services has acquired five Xerox ColorQubes that will allow campus users to make color copies and create scans that can be sent to e-mail. Scanning to e-mail is free to all users. Black and white copies are 10 cents per side, while color copies are 20 cents per side.
As with all of our walk-up copiers, activation cards may be purchased from IT or from the library’s front desk. The machines are located in the Hoover second-floor lobby, the second-floor mezzanine in the Stevens Center, the MLRC’s first-floor copier center, and the VAC lobby. The fifth machine is in Print Services, where customers will be able to print from their own computers, student kiosk computers, or copy and then make payment to the staff.
Please note that the Xerox ColorQube will print black and white or color, so be sure to designate what you want. Also, this is “solid ink†technology (crayon), so an item printed/copied from the ColorQube will not be able to go through a heat-based process (lamination).

Scott Rueck, the coach who guided George Fox to a 2009 national D-III women’s basketball championship and seven conference titles in 14 seasons, has written an open letter to thank the university community for its unwavering support over the years. Rueck announced earlier this month he was leaving George Fox to take the head women’s basketball job at Oregon State University, his alma mater.
